- Vad returnerar Wpdb -> Get_results?
- Hur får jag resultatet av min WordPress-databas?
- Hur använder jag WordPress Wpdb?
- När ska du använda Wpdb?
- Hur uppdaterar jag en fråga i WordPress?
- Hur hämtar jag en matris i WordPress?
- Hur infogar jag flera rader i en WordPress-databas?
- Hur hittar jag mitt nuvarande användar-ID i WordPress?
- Var lagras WordPress-databasen?
- Vad är anpassad fråga i WordPress?
- Vad är $ Wpdb-variabeln i WordPress?
- Hur skriver jag ut en infogningsfråga i WordPress?
Vad returnerar Wpdb -> Get_results?
Funktionen get_results () returnerar hela frågeresultatet som en matris där varje element motsvarar en rad i frågeresultatet. Liksom get_row () kan varje rad lagras i ett objekt, en associerande matris eller en numeriskt indexerad matris. ... php $ wpdb->get_results ('query', output_type); ?>
Hur får jag resultatet av min WordPress-databas?
Som standard inställs $ wpdb för att prata med WordPress-databasen. $ resultat = $ GLOBALS ['wpdb']->get_results ("VÄLJ * FRÅN $ wpdb->prefix alternativ WHERE option_id = 1 ", OBJECT); $ wpdb-objektet kan användas för att läsa data från vilken tabell som helst i WordPress-databasen, inte bara de som skapats av WordPress själv.
Hur använder jag WordPress Wpdb?
Infoga funktion
$ wpdb-> ;; infoga ($ wpdb-> ;; postmeta, array ('post_id' => ;; 1, 'meta_key' => ;; 'pris', 'meta_value' => ;; '500'), array ('% d', '% s', '% s')); Ovanstående kod infogar en rad i postmetatabellen med värdena för post_id som 1, meta_key som pris och meta_value som 500.
När ska du använda Wpdb?
3 svar. Det är bästa praxis att alltid använda förberedelser men den huvudsakliga användningen av det är att förhindra mot SQL-injektionsattacker, och eftersom det inte finns någon input från användare / besökare eller de inte kan påverka frågan är det inte ett problem i ditt nuvarande exempel.
Hur uppdaterar jag en fråga i WordPress?
“Uppdatera fråga wordpress” Kodsvar
- global $ wpdb;
- $ dbData = array ();
- $ dbData ['last_login_time'] = tid ();
- $ wpdb->uppdatering ('table_name', $ dbData, array ('user_id' => 1));
Hur hämtar jag en matris i WordPress?
Med en av de tre första returnerar du en rad rader indexerade från 0 med SQL-resultatradnummer. Varje rad är en associerande matris (kolumn => värde, ...), en numeriskt indexerad matris (0 => värde, ...) eller ett objekt ( ->kolumn = värde).
Hur infogar jag flera rader i en WordPress-databas?
$ kvm . = implodera (", \ n", $ platshållare);
...
Enkel WordPress-bulkinsats
- Ange ett tabellnamn och en uppsättning associerande matriser av rader som ska infogas.
- Kolumnnamn dras automatiskt från den första raden med data.
- Se till att du anger samma fält i varje rad (det finns inget skydd för detta)
Hur hittar jag mitt nuvarande användar-ID i WordPress?
8 sätt att få användar-ID på WordPress
- Logga in på din WordPress-administratör.
- Gå till användare > Alla användare.
- Välj användaren och gå till hans profil.
- Titta på sidans URL:
Var lagras WordPress-databasen?
WordPress använder nästan säkert en MySQL-databas för att lagra dess innehåll, och de lagras vanligtvis någon annanstans på systemet, ofta / var / lib / mysql / some_db_name . Öppna din wp-config. php-fil och börja titta på dina MySQL-inställningar.
Vad är anpassad fråga i WordPress?
Fråga är en term som används för att beskriva handlingen att välja, infoga eller uppdatera data i en databas. ... $ fråga = ny WP_Query ('cat = 12'); Resultatet kommer att innehålla alla inlägg inom den kategorin som sedan kan visas med en mall. Utvecklare kan också fråga WordPress-databasen direkt genom att ringa in $ wpdb-klassen.
Vad är $ Wpdb-variabeln i WordPress?
Som standard är $ wpdb-variabeln en förekomst av wpdb-klassen som ansluter till WordPress-databasen definierad i wp-config. php . Om vi vill interagera med andra databaser kan vi starta en annan instans av wpdb-klass.
Hur skriver jag ut en infogningsfråga i WordPress?
Jag har listat ner tre tillvägagångssätt här:
- Använda SAVEQUERIES och skriva ut alla frågor i sidfoten.
- Använda $ wpdb->last_query för att bara skriva ut den senaste frågan som körs, detta är användbart för felsökningsfunktioner.
- Med hjälp av ett plugin som Query Monitor.